This paper presents an experimental comparison of three different biasing elements utilized to produce out-of-plane actuation for a diaphragm dielectric electro-active polymer (DEAP). A hanging mass, a linear coil spring, and a nonlinear (bistable) mechanism are individually paired with an unloaded DEAP actuator. High voltage (2.5 kV) is applied to the DEAP and the out-of-plane stroke of the DEAP is measured. The actuator stroke is notably different for each bias element. Results show that as the bias element stiffness increases, the actuator stroke decreases. However, the bistable element, when coupled with the DEAP, demonstrated improved actuation in a specific range of DEAP pre-deflection. Not only was the stroke larger for this case, the stroke also did not attenuate at higher voltage frequencies as much as the linear coil spring bias elements. This study demonstrates a promising method for obtaining high performance DEAP actuators in the future.
